/**
* A Maven execution session.
*
* @author Jason van Zyl
*/
public class MavenSession
implements Cloneable
{
private MavenExecutionRequest request;
private MavenExecutionResult result;
private RepositorySystemSession repositorySession;
private Properties executionProperties;
private MavenProject currentProject;
/**
* These projects have already been topologically sorted in the {@link org.apache.maven.Maven} component before
* being passed into the session. This is also the potentially constrained set of projects by using --projects
* on the command line.
*/
private List<MavenProject> projects;
/**
* The full set of projects before any potential constraining by --projects. Useful in the case where you want to
* build a smaller set of projects but perform other operations in the context of your reactor.
*/
private List<MavenProject> allProjects;
private MavenProject topLevelProject;
private ProjectDependencyGraph projectDependencyGraph;
private boolean parallel;
/**
* Plugin context keyed by project ({@link MavenProject#getId()}) and by plugin lookup key
* ({@link PluginDescriptor#getPluginLookupKey()}). Plugin contexts itself are mappings of {@link String} keys to
* {@link Object} values.
*/
@SuppressWarnings( "checkstyle:linelength" )
private final ConcurrentMap<String, ConcurrentMap<String, ConcurrentMap<String, Object>>> pluginContextsByProjectAndPluginKey =
new ConcurrentHashMap<>();
public void setProjects( List<MavenProject> projects )
{
if ( !projects.isEmpty() )
{
this.currentProject = projects.get( 0 );
this.topLevelProject = currentProject;
for ( MavenProject project : projects )
{
if ( project.isExecutionRoot() )
{
topLevelProject = project;
break;
}
}
}
else
{
this.currentProject = null;
this.topLevelProject = null;
}
this.projects = projects;
}
public ArtifactRepository getLocalRepository()
{
return request.getLocalRepository();
}
public List<String> getGoals()
{
return request.getGoals();
}
/**
* Gets the user properties to use for interpolation and profile activation. The user properties have been
* configured directly by the user on his discretion, e.g. via the {@code -Dkey=value} parameter on the command
* line.
*
* @return The user properties, never {@code null}.
*/
public Properties getUserProperties()
{
return request.getUserProperties();
}
/**
* Gets the system properties to use for interpolation and profile activation. The system properties are collected
* from the runtime environment like {@link System#getProperties()} and environment variables.
*
* @return The system properties, never {@code null}.
*/
public Properties getSystemProperties()
{
return request.getSystemProperties();
}
